As Kurt has already pointed out, the trade talks for Orioles second baseman Brian Roberts has died today. In the wake of this news, I feel compelled to say a few words about the trade talks that we all got to know so well.

Trade talks…what to say about dear ole trade talks. You were only a part of our lives for four months, but it has seemed like an eternity since we lived in a time without you. You came to us as an interesting little rumor but you quickly grew into a serious topic of conversation and object of desire for the Cubs and their fans.

I’ll never forget that smile that I saw across the front pages of the Tribune and Sun-Times’ websites as I read the latest information on your development. It always made me dream of the future we could have had together if you weren’t so cruelly taken away from us.

We’ve had good times speculating which Cubs players would have been involved with you (the likes of Cedeno, Murton, and Gallagher come to mind) and how you might bring stability to our amoeba-like batting order.

Sure, you were tainted by accusations and admittance of steroid usage, but who among us is not without sin?

You taunted us, teased us, and (for most Cubs fans) tortured us with your existence. Your departure from our world may be depressing for the dreamers, but for most, we are now presented with an opportunity to move on with our lives…

…until July when we will start this all over again.
